Demolition with explosive Capendeguy district - France Béziers: demolition of 492 apartments for a total of 300.000 cubic meters of concrete demolished in just 11 seconds. The eco-monster, “Barre de Capendeguy” was built in the 1970s. It was a difficult job as it was located near the city centre. The project lasted about six months before reaching the final stage: the implosion of the building. Were used explosives by 450 kilos of dynamite were used and 65,000 tons of debris were collected, then crushed and separated before being transferred to a nearby quarry, where the materials were recovered by special equipment to be reused as a filling for road foundations.

A14 Highway bridge The challenge of modernizing the Italian infrastructure is among the largest and most complex in the country and we have 50 bridges to demolish of the A14 highway in the stretch between Rimini and Senigallia. This is part of the work for widening and building a third lane of the A4 BolognaBari motorway, one of the busiest and most important in Italy. Work must be performed during night hours (one bridge per night) to avoid creating problems for traffic, especially intense during the day. These operations are extremely delicate, due to the context and the complexity of the operation to be performed. The planning and execution of demolition is studied down to the smallest details to minimize any risk and can be performed only by companies with advanced technologies and equipment, that make security and timekeeping priorities.

Venice - Giudecca Island DEMOLITION ON GIUDECCA ISLAND, VENICE This is the most delicate operation performed by our company, because the buildings were in the middle of an inhabited area. The building had been built between 1928 and 1930, had 3 to 4 floors and a surface area of about 20,000 m3. Suitable barges were made to transport the machinery to the island.

PETROCHEMICAL Experience allows Vitali to demolish and clear the chemical and petrochemical plants contaminated by flammable substances and carcinogenic substances, sewage treatment plants, tanks, boilers etc. It is a specialist able to provide an integrated service in the field of environmental redevelopment, reclamation and decommissioning of free gas industrial plants onshore and offshore gas plants. We redevelop using the most advanced technologies, ensuring the sustainability and protection of the territory. Our activities range from cleaning up to environmental redevelopment. At the industrial sites, the demolition takes place at various stages of decontamination and decommissioning, by optimizing the overall management of the operation. Vitali has Atex approved equipment, to be used especially in the rdecontamination of tanks and chemical plants, these activities are mainly carried out using automated systems; the approval of the machinery and equipment ensures maximum reliability when working in the presence of explosive mixtures. Vitali also provides technology for hydro-demolition of concrete works by hydrodynamic milling at very high pressures (up to 2,800 bar).

Tonale tunnel - Pedelombarda The Tonale tunnel demolitions, essential for the construction of the future “Copreno Tunnel” and the expansion of the roadway, will allow the new highway to be linked to the current SS 35 (Milan-Meda) with the Pedemontana Lombarda B1 segment (one of the most complex and important highway works in the Lombardy region). A determinant work factor: tight schedule. Demolition work involved four macro phases and included the “gradually” demolition starting from the Milan direction tunnel side and proceeding towards Como. The first macro phase involved the reduction of the plant ground over the tunnel cover slab, fully freeing the reinforced cement slab. Next, the external sides of the tunnel were reduced to make the execution of anchor ties possible for support works. With the beginning of excavations on the tunnel sides, Vitali strictly proceeded by parallel progress steps on both sides so that the tunnel structures would not suffer asymmetric force by the surrounding land. The tunnel demolition phase scheme is always the same: from top down and on a single barrel at a time. To conclude the complex work, the demolition of the platform and walls; the demolition of the central portion and, proceeding with the same work method, the demolition of the last tunnel portion. The last phase, the demolition of the foundation works. Waste material was ground processed before being taken to disposal.

DEMOLITION OF CORRIERE DELLA SERA HEAD OFFICE IN MILAN

Special features of the work included the urban context as the building in question was in the city centre near homes and commercial structures. The buildings, part of the urban fabric, required the use of resources and innovative equipment and technology to ensure minimal environmental impact, both acoustic and as regards the emission of dust. This allowed minor impact on the protection of citizens, limiting vibrations and noise propagation. The area of work covered 40,000 m2 with heights of about 15 metres.

The demolition of the building of RCS Media Group Spa, Via Rizzoli, Milan in anticipation of the redevelopment of the area was a highly symbolic job. It was a complex of buildings built by famous architects of the ‘60s. From a technical standpoint, this was not a simple job: part of the buildings, especially the Lotto 6 “project Martinelli,” is the actual place of business of RCS Media Group SpA, which houses the cafeteria, business services and some offices. For this reason, the demolition plan was developed in stages, thereby allowing the transfer of activities carried on and the subsequent reclamation of the area. The total volume was 161,500 cubic metres and the height was over 26 metres in some points.

Orio al Serio International Airport Work that concerned the runway was divided into three subsequent phases; the first focused on the West side and North area of the aircraft lot (safety area 10) and that did not restrict flights. From April 26th, still guarantee airport operating continuity, the second phase was launched that concerned the opposite safety area to the East of the runway (safety area 28). The third and final phase, completed between May 13th and Just 1st, 2014 for a total of 20 days, concerned the central part of the runway and taxiways for an overall length of about 2 k, during which the runway was fully closed.

An unprecedented intervention, included in the operating context of the fourth largest Italian airport in terms of passenger transit and first in cargo. A strategic operation that aims to further boost the Bergamo airport, especially in light of the 2015 Expo, and to continue the pursuit for a spot on the podium for highest passenger transit in our country.

Temporary joint venture: Vitali Spa 60% of the total Work amount: 50 million Start of work: March 2014 End of work: June 2014

The contract, totalling around 2 million, is included in a larger renovation and expansion project that required an overall investment of approximately 20 million. To complete work, the Olbia airport was closed to air traffic from midnight on Monday, March 2nd to midnight on Saturday, March 7th, 2015. Just 6 days of intense work dividing the 24h into 3 shifts.

Vitali Spa’s umpteenth race against time: renovating the Olbia “Costa Smeralda” Italian airport runway, especially used in the summer months.

About 80 men worked in three shifts with one hundred perfectly coordinated machines to guarantee the new paving (about 5,000 tonnes) and position of about 150 AVL systems (visual aid lighting - aircraft navigation support runway lights).

The contract concerns the entire runway re-pavement works (airport closed from March 2-7 with uninterrupted 24h work); following this phase, work also concerned the sub-foundation for the sole operating airport link. Old AVL (visual aid lighting) systems were also removed; the new bases relocated under the asphalt strip and then all runway lights (relocated after the new asphalt was laid), laying new raceways for their wiring. Lastly, horizontal signs were renovated.

Stabilisation and Regeneration

THE METHODOLOGY This methodology has been widely experimented as used for decades in many countries such as Germany, France and the USA. Stabilisation of soil using lime and/ or cement allows the use of soils with unsuitable characteristics for the formation of embankments in general (e.g. clay and/or lime based materials) by treating the same material in loco. There are considerable short and long-term advantages in using this methodology thanks to the reactions generated by the limestone that continue over time, and can be summarised as follows: • Marked increase of the bearing capacity of the treated terrain; • Abatement of the impact of water on clay-lime based materials; • Increased resistance against erosion and freeze-thaw phenomenon. • Elimination of fine clay-based particles in the layer of treated terrain; • Increase in the level of utilisation of the treated terrain.
